Groomed for a spectrum of audio applications, the 200-MHz TMS320C6722, 250-MHz TMS320C6726, and 300-MHz TMS320C6727 floating-point digital signal processors employ a C67x-based core, which is described as a C-efficient, VLIW architecture offering significant improvements. These include a dMAX DMA engine, mixed instructions (32-bit x 32-bit and 32-bit x 64-bit multiplication with 64-bit results), a flat-memory model, 64 internal registers, and a 32 KB instruction cache. Although the number of peripherals varies depending on the processor, each device includes up to three McASPs, an HPI, RTI, EMIF, and two SPI interfaces, two I2C interfaces, and one PLL. Design support is available via the Professional Audio Development Kit (PADK) from Lyrtech Signal Processing. The kit allows users to evaluate device performance and begin product development without having to first develop a prototype board. Sampling now with production scheduled for the fourth quarter, volume prices for the C6722, C6726, and C6727 are $9.95, $14.10, and $19.95, respectively. Price for the PADK is $1,995.
